钱包风暴下的安全导航:tp钱包闪退背后的多维分析与应对

当指尖触碰屏幕,账本却在云层里打了个响指,闪退成为临场的隐形对手。

从用户角度,tp钱包的闪退不仅带来资金风险,也挤压了信任基石。系统层面的原因往往错综复杂:设备差异、内存压力、第三方库兼容性、以及最新操作系统对安全沙箱的更新。问题并非单点故障,而是多维耦合的结果。常见根因可以归为三类:一是客户端资源管理不当导致内存不足或分配异常,二是网络请求的并发与取消策略失效,三是对离线签名流和交易广播的状态机设计不健壮。若以tp钱包的闪退为切入口,往往能看到整体架构的薄弱环节,而这些环节恰恰决定了钱包在真实场景中的抗压能力。

安全应急预案是第一道防线。读者若从事钱包类产品开发,应建立一个分级、可执行的 incident response 流程。监测与告警是前提:持续追踪崩溃率、异常崩溃地点、设备分布、以及版本落地与依赖库的版本关系。事件分级要有明确的响应时限与人员分工,低风险可以采用热修复外包的方式,中风险以上需要快速制订回滚与补丁策略。对外沟通需透明但克制,避免恐慌性广播,同时准备技术性公告与用户指引。修复阶段强调最小化变更、对关键路径的回归测试,以及对第三方依赖的版本锁定与兼容性验证。最后,事后复盘应形成可落地的改进清单,覆盖代码、测试、发布流程及监控仪表盘。

在碳信用交易场景下,钱包作为碳信用代币的承载工具,其鲁棒性直接关系到市场信任。碳信用交易的区块链应用强调可追溯性、可验证性与合规性。为此,钱包需要支持碳信用代币的标准化映射、交易对账与合规字段的嵌入式校验,确保交易记录可被审计且在跨国监管框架下可追溯。风险点包括代币标准兼容性、跨链映射的延迟与错位、以及对碳信用市场波动的抗冲击能力。一个稳健的碳信用钱包应具备分层权限、可证实的资产来源,以及对异常交易的触发式审阅机制。

在功能调试工具方面,开发团队应建立多维度可观测性。日志要覆盖交易广播、签名流程、并发队列与内存分配的关键节点;崩溃日志应配合崩溃分析工具与本地化回放。常用工具包括移动端的日志框架、远程诊断平台、以及性能分析工具,如 Android Studio Profiler 和 Xcode Instruments。远程调试与热修复能力应具备非侵入性与数据脱敏策略。对跨版本的回归测试,建议引入自动化用例库、 fuzz 测试与静态代码分析,以尽早暴露潜在漏洞。

跨链桥服务是对外部生态的接入点,也是风险的高发地。桥接机制涉及资产锁定、签名验证、以及跨链消息传递的幂等性控制。为降低风险,推荐采用多重签名或阈值签名的桥接架构、独立的监控端与应急解锁流程,以及对桥的状态机进行形式化建模与时序分析。必要时引入独立的审计链路与观察者服务,确保在桥头发生异常时能及时冻结相关资产与交易。

合约导出方面,钱包应提供可核验的合约导出能力。导出包括 ABI、字节码与可验证的源代码。对导出内容,要求具备版本标识、编译器版本、Solidity 段落选项的记录,以及与链上状态一致性的对比工具。合约导出不仅有助于用户自查与第三方审计,也方便团队进行后续的安全审查与升级迁移。

资产分布式访问控制强调“最小权限”和“去中心化信任机制”。可采用分布式身份 DID、基于角色的访问控制与阈值机制,确保设备、用户、以及应用组件在不同层级拥有合适的访问粒度。数据与密钥的存取应采用分布式存储与秘密分享方案,降低单点故障风险。实现路径包括跨设备多设备同态认证、离线签名容错与密钥轮换策略,以及对关键操作的多方确认与日志留存。

详细描述分析流程,便于团队在真实场景中落地落地再落地。第一步,建立可复现的问题场景:在受控设备、不同操作系统版本及网络条件下尝试复现闪退。第二步,数据采集与聚合:收集崩溃日志、诊断报告、内存转储与交易轨迹。第三步,初步诊断:检查内存泄漏、线程竞争、依赖冲突、以及输入输出异常。第四步,深入分析:结合形式化建模与静态/动态分析,定位引发崩退的核心路径与状态机缺陷。第五步,影响评估与风险量化:评估失败对资金、数据完整性与市场信任的影响,给出修复优先级。第六步,修复与回归:提出修复方案、编写回归用例、执行跨版本回归测试与端到端验证。第七步,发布与监控:分阶段发布,更新监控指标,建立事后审查机制。第八步,持续改进:将发现的问题纳入安全基线、更新培训材料和开发规范,形成闭环。

参考权威文献与行业最佳实践亦不可或缺。关于事件处置,采用的框架可参考国家层面的信息安全指南与国际标准,如 NIST 的安全事件响应指南、ISO/IEC 27001 的信息安全管理体系,以及移动应用安全最佳实践。对于碳信用交易领域,World Bank 的碳 pricing 与市场报告,以及公开的碳信用标准化研究,可为在钱包层面实现合规性提供参考。合约导出与审计方面,OpenZeppelin 的安全最佳实践、以太坊黄皮书及主流静态分析工具的输出也应纳入评审。

综上,tp钱包闪退不仅是技术故障,更是系统设计、治理与风险管理的综合考验。通过建立完善的安全应急预案、对碳信用交易的端到端支持、工具链的全面调试能力、稳健的跨链桥设计、透明的合约导出流程以及强化的资产分布式访问控制,我们能够在风暴中保持钱包的可用性、可信赖性与合规性。

参考文献(示例性)

- NIST SP 800-61 Rev. 2, Computer Security Incident Handling Guide

- ISO/IEC 27001:2013, Information Security Management

- World Bank, State of Carbon Pricing 2023/2024

- Ethereum Yellow Paper, Vitalik Buterin

- OpenZeppelin Security Best Practices

- Mobile App Security Best Practices (行业公开指南)

互动投票与探讨问题:

- 你认为在 tp 钱包闪退时,优先解决哪一环:核心流程、依赖库还是网络层?

- 你支持桥接采用多重签名策略以提升安全性吗?请投票选择。

- 对于碳信用代币,钱包应实现严格的交易合规审阅还是以用户自我申报为主?

- 是否愿意参与钱包的安全演练(模拟攻击、应急响应演练)?

作者:林泽宇发布时间:2026-01-04 17:57:08

评论

Nova Chen

这篇文章把安全预案和跨链风险讲得很清晰,尤其是对实际场景的落地指导很有帮助。

龙之行者

关于碳信用交易的落地问题,文中给出的多重签名和审阅机制很有启发性,值得团队参考。

CryptoWiz

深度分析到位,合约导出与分布式访问控制部分尤其实用,帮助我司加速内审流程。

Pixel艺术家

调试工具清单很实用,准备在下个迭代中落地,感谢详细的指导。

Alex

希望增加一个简短的演练清单,方便企业快速部署安全演练与应急演习。

相关阅读
<noscript lang="qcg3o"></noscript>
<kbd dropzone="kb9di"></kbd><em dir="wc9dy"></em><center dropzone="2w_i2"></center><map lang="_j19x"></map><i lang="gc45w"></i> <var lang="yxm_"></var><time lang="r5ss"></time><abbr dir="xwh2"></abbr><del draggable="d5mz"></del><b lang="_1s6"></b><small date-time="d8c4"></small><map id="9za0"></map>